The Enduring Appeal of Athlete-Family Dynamics: Lessons from Dominique Dawes and Jeff Thompson

The story of Olympic gymnast Dominique Dawes and her husband, Jeff Thompson, resonates far beyond the world of sports. It’s a narrative of faith, family, and navigating life’s challenges – a theme increasingly captivating audiences. Their journey, marked by both triumph and heartache, offers a glimpse into the evolving expectations and realities of modern athlete-family life, and points to several emerging trends.

The Rise of the ‘Whole Life’ Athlete

For decades, athletes were often defined solely by their performance. Today, there’s a growing demand for athletes to be relatable, well-rounded individuals. Dawes’ openness about her family life, her faith, and even her struggles with miscarriage humanizes her, fostering a deeper connection with fans. This trend is fueled by social media, which allows athletes to control their narratives and present a more complete picture of themselves. A recent study by Nielsen found that 66% of fans feel a stronger connection to athletes who are active on social media and share personal stories.

Jeff Thompson’s role is also significant. He isn’t simply “the spouse of an Olympian”; he’s a dedicated educator who balances his career with supporting his wife and raising their four children. This challenges traditional gender roles and highlights the importance of partnership in navigating the demands of a high-profile life.

The Impact of Miscarriage Awareness

Dawes’ openness about her miscarriage scare before the birth of her twins is incredibly impactful. It contributes to a broader conversation about reproductive health and challenges the stigma surrounding miscarriage. According to the American Pregnancy Association, approximately 10-20% of known pregnancies end in miscarriage. Sharing these experiences can provide comfort and support to others who have gone through similar losses.

FAQ

Q: What is Dominique Dawes doing now?
A: Dominique Dawes continues to be involved in gymnastics through her academy, motivational speaking engagements, and media appearances.

Q: What does Jeff Thompson teach?
A: Jeff Thompson teaches at The Heights School in Potomac, Maryland.

Q: How many children do Dominique Dawes and Jeff Thompson have?
A: They have four children: daughters Kateri and Quinn, and twin sons Dakota and Lincoln.

Did you know? Dominique Dawes was the first African American woman to win an individual medal in Olympic gymnastics.
